Output 475c8186b6a6831e1fe4a54244c22659f7a4d8684160ba4e77dc06abe83e2f4e:0

value
52712705
script pubkey
OP_0 OP_PUSHBYTES_20 f3cf383e33eae54f324dc4d9d1ee814a873dc7b7
address
bc1q708ns03natj57vjdcnvarm5pf2rnm3ahfvssd8
transaction
475c8186b6a6831e1fe4a54244c22659f7a4d8684160ba4e77dc06abe83e2f4e
confirmations
169262
spent
true